The Itinerary: Tailored and Scenic

The beauty of this tour lies in its customizability. The first stop is typically the Blue Ridge Mountains, but where exactly you go depends on your preferences. Reviews highlight that guides offer several options, ensuring you get to visit locations that excite you most. Whether it’s a waterfall, mountain vista, or scenic overlook, the choice is yours—and your guide ensures you get the best shots possible.

The 5-hour timeframe strikes a good balance, allowing enough time to explore multiple spots without feeling rushed. The inclusion of admission tickets to the selected locations means fewer surprises or extra costs, making it easier to plan your day.

The Scenic Spots and Locations

While the exact destinations depend on your preferences, reviewers mention visiting waterfalls and viewpoints along the Blue Ridge Parkway. One review from Kerrie_N recounts how her group was driven to waterfalls and scenic overlooks, even amid foggy weather. The guide’s flexibility in adjusting plans based on weather conditions ensures the experience remains rewarding, regardless of the forecast.

Frequently Asked Questions

Custom Half-Day Photo Tour with Photography Lessons from Asheville -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need to bring my own photography gear?
Yes, the tour does not provide equipment, so you’ll want to bring your own camera or smartphone.

Is the tour suitable for all skill levels?
Absolutely. Reviews mention guides working well with both beginners and experienced photographers.

What is included in the price?
Private transportation, hotel pickup, bottled water, snacks, and a printout of photography tips.

Can I customize my stops during the tour?
Yes, the itinerary is tailored to your interests, with the guide offering several options for locations.

How long is the tour?
Approximately 5 hours, giving you plenty of time to explore and take photos without feeling rushed.

What happens if the weather is bad?
Guides are flexible and will adjust plans based on weather conditions, ensuring you still get great photo opportunities.

Is the tour private or group?
It’s a private tour, so only your group participates, allowing for personalized attention.

Are meals included?
No, meals are not included. You might want to bring your own lunch or plan to eat after the tour.

How far in advance should I book?
Most travelers book around 16 days in advance, but it’s wise to reserve sooner during peak times.

Is there a minimum or maximum group size?
Since it’s private, the experience is designed for your group only, from just a couple to a small party.
